我已经使用他们的gem将foundation安装到我的Rails项目中,并运行以下两个命令:rails g foundation:layout
一切似乎都运行得很好但是,我的单选按钮和复选框看起来并没有什么不同。说,“一旦初始化(它们指的是自动包含在每个Rails页面中的jquery.foundation.forms.js ),它将查找任何复选框、单选按钮或选择元素,并将其替换为
但是我想给这个表单带来一个新特性,取决于某种条件,取决于MyProperty2 of MyObjectToEdit,我想继续显示该窗体,但禁用它:必须向用户显示所有窗体,但用户不能编辑任何内容并单击“保存如果MyProperty2为真,则窗体继续是可编辑的,否则必须禁用窗体。但是我不知道如何用最少的代码来影响它,在我的剃须刀上看到表单的呈现。我有一个解决方案,但是看起来太“不干净”了:我用javascript和css禁用了表单的所有元素。
在剃须刀视图中是否有任何mvc、html助手或类似的东西来禁用表单